Information regarding the key visual and theme songs for the second cour of the TV anime Hell Teacher Nube, scheduled to begin broadcasting in January 2026, has been released.

The newly unveiled visual features a young Nube reaching out to his homeroom teacher at the time, Minako-sensei. Looming behind them, poised to strike, is Baki, the strongest demon dwelling in hell. Nube’s desperate, pleading expression hints at the fierce intensity of the narrative to come. What tragedy occurred during his boyhood? Who exactly is Minako-sensei? In the second cour, Nube’s past and the secret of the “Demon Hand”—a mystery unknown even to Hiro and Kyoko—will finally be revealed.
The opening theme for the second cour will be “ERASE” by THE ORAL CIGARETTES, while the ending theme will be “MAGICAL” by Ayumu Imazu.
About the TV Anime Hell Teacher Nube
This series is an occult hero action story based on the original manga by Shou Makura and Takeshi Okano. The anime is produced by Studio KAI, with Yasuyuki Oishi serving as director and Fumito Yamada as assistant director. Series composition is handled by Yoshiki Okusa, character design by Yuu Yoshiyama, and sub-character design by Atsuko Takahashi. Yokai designs are provided by Hiroki Tanaka and Kijimaru, with sound direction by Yasushi Nagura and music composed by Evan Call.

Synopsis
Domori Town is plagued by frequent, inexplicable supernatural phenomena. To protect the children, a single teacher has been assigned to Domori Elementary School: Meisuke Nueno, the homeroom teacher of Class 5-3, commonly known as “Nube.” Although he is usually gentle and a bit of a klutz, he possesses a secret identity as Japan’s only spirit medium teacher. Rumor has it that a demon resides within his left hand. As a messenger of justice from hell, Nube confronts the school’s “Seven Wonders,” yokai, and evil spirits to defend his students.
Cast
The voice cast features Ryotaro Okiayu as Meisuke Nueno, Ryoko Shiraishi as Hiroshi Tateno, Aya Suzaki as Kyoko Inaba, Tomoyo Kurosawa as Miki Hosokawa, Ryota Iwasaki as Katsuya Kimura, Shiho Kokido as Makoto Kurita, Aya Endo as Ritsuko Takahashi, Ai Kakuma as Yukime, and Toshiyuki Morikawa as Kyosuke Tamamo.
